Mars had to endure a six-game losing streak, but that streak is no more. They simply couldn't be stopped on Friday as they easily beat the Blackhawk Cougars 83-42. The final result isn't all that surprising considering the Fightin' Planets' considerable advantage in MaxPreps' Pennsylvania basketball rankings (they are ranked 232nd, while the Cougars are ranked 492nd).
Mars' victory bumped their record up to 7-8. As for Blackhawk, their loss was their ninth straight on the road dating back to last season, which dropped their record down to 6-10.
Coming up, Mars will head out to take on Avonworth at 7:30 p.m. on Tuesday. As for Blackhawk, they will host West Allegheny at 7:30 p.m. on Tuesday.
